Hey,

I'm a new user of FitSync - and it looks right up my street and just what I need.

However - my gym is kind of in a bunker underground and there is no internet access.  I have a HTC Hero device running Android but without a connection I can't access the site, so logging my sessions is going to be impossible.

It is a pity (and I'm sure this has been raised before) that there are not apps for Android devices (and iPhone I guess, boo hiss!) so that the workouts can be downloaded to the phone for offline access - and then when a internet connection comes back the workout details are sync'd back.

Is this in the pipeline do you know?  It would turn a great tool into an unmissable tool in my opinion.

Hey Arran-
Thanks for checking in, appreciate the feedback. 

We do have an offline version for Android which lets you close the app and then relaunch offline (you don't need to keep the browser open) so you can log your workouts down in the bunker and then sync later when you come out.  However, this version only works for Android 2.0 Eclair so you might have to wait a bit before they upgrade the Hero. 

We also have some other upgrades coming in the next few weeks but we'll send out some global messages to advise when they go live.
